According to The Hollywood Reporter, Alex Newell, who stars as Wade Adams -- aka Unique -- on Fox's musical comedy GLEE, has signed with Atlantic Records and will release his debut album with Glee executive music producer Adam Anders' Deep Well imprint.

"Singing is my passion and to now have the opportunity to make my own music is a dream come true!" Newell said. "I can't thank my new Atlantic and Deep Well family enough for welcoming me with open arms."

Newell was the runner-up on the first season of Oxygen's THE Glee PROJECT and made his Glee debut in a two-episode arc. He is now a series regular on season five.

Newell has made celebrity appearances on Home & Family, Good Day L.A., Teens Wann Know, Masterchef, the 2013 Do Something Awards and this year's Teen Choice Awards.

He will next be seen in the movie Geography Club, set for release this month.
